I am a Canadian Permanent Resident. Newlywed, we got married recently in India and she is an Indian Citizen. I read CIC is aware of Dual Intentions during Temporary Residence Visa(TRV) application and Visitor Visa will still be processed separately and approved if its requirements are fulfilled.
We are considering the following route:
1. Apply for her Temporary Visitor Visa from India so that she can Travel to Canada. We can provide strong ties for her with India to prove she will return to India.
2. Once she is in Canada, apply for all three: Open Work Permit, sponsor application and PR application together (I read in CIC website that applying all three together is usual process). This Open Work Permit will help her stay until PR application is completed.
Now, my questions are:
1. Have you or any of your friends followed this route?
2. Is it ok to mention this dual intention plan in our Tourist Visa application as a note to Visa Officer? Will it work against our TRV Visitor Visa?
3. Should we mention this route in TRV application?
We feel it is better to be honest and let visa office know our intention. We are also planning to add details on worst case scenario that if her PR is not approved then we intend to live in India together until we find alternate options and that we do not intend to overstay in any case.
